Ro is seeking an experienced attorney to serve as Pharmacy Counsel, embedded within our growing legal team. This role will be the go-to legal partner for pharmacy operations and compliance across our owned and partner pharmacy networks. This is a strategic, high-impact role with significant cross-functional exposure, working closely with pharmacy operations, corporate quality, and other key stakeholders.
What You’ll Do:
- Lead Ro’s pharmacy law strategy, advising on both day-to-day pharmacy operations and long-term business initiatives.
- Own the legal relationship with pharmacy operations and corporate quality teams as their primary point of contact.
- Ensure pharmacy compliance by advising on licensure, inspections, DSCSA obligations, and safety and quality assurance requirements.
- Monitor and analyze state Board of Pharmacy developments, assess regulatory risks, and shape Ro’s government relations strategy to proactively manage regulatory change.
- Help lead responses to inspections, investigations, regulatory inquiries, and other legal escalations.
- Partner closely with senior FDA counsel to ensure pharmacy operations comply with FDA regulations and guidance.
- Collaborate cross-functionally with product, operations, and quality teams to accelerate new product launches, partnerships, and facility expansions.
What You’ll Bring to the Team:
- J.D. from an accredited law school and licensed to practice law in at least one U.S. jurisdiction.5–9 years of experience advising on pharmacy law.
- In-depth experience with legal and regulatory frameworks relevant to pharmacy operations, including compounding.
- Experience working in-house, preferably with or within online pharmacies or health tech platforms.
- Comfortable navigating and advising on ambiguous or evolving regulatory environments.
- Track record of successful collaboration across legal, regulatory, quality, and operations teams.
- Ability to manage competing priorities and give practical, risk-based legal advice quickly.
